Multiplexer Technology: Applications and Benefits in Electronic Design

Multiplexers are fundamental components in electronic design, facilitating the efficient routing of signals within complex circuits. By utilizing a minimal number of control lines, multiplexers allow for the selective selection of one input signal from various available options to be transmitted to a single output. This adaptable nature makes multiplexers indispensable in a wide range of applications.

  • In telecommunications, multiplexers are crucial for merging multiple data signals onto a single transmission medium, maximizing bandwidth utilization and enhancing communication efficiency.
  • Within computer systems, multiplexers play a vital role in addressing memory locations and identifying specific registers for data processing. This streamlines memory access operations, contributing to overall system performance.
  • Additionally, multiplexers find applications in digital signal processing (DSP) circuits, where they are used for implementing demodulators and other signal manipulation tasks.

The benefits of using multiplexers in electronic design are manifold. They offer substantial space savings compared to conventional switching methods, as they can control multiple signals with a limited number of components.

Moreover, multiplexers cdil contribute to increased productivity by minimizing the power consumption and complexity of circuits. Their integral capability for signal routing makes them essential building blocks in modern electronic systems.
